Subject: fsck-cache problem
Date: Sat, 23 Apr 2005 21:55:20 -0400	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<118833cc0504231855145c10a5@mail.gmail.com> (raw)

While downloading the sparse git database I got impatient and ran
fsck-cache on it.
I got...

...
missing (null) ff515b91674ff2f5b082a927676dbf392d04d9ce
missing (null) ff94be6fbcce10b83824defbdc2f8819121bbd4d
missing (null) ffa4ddda950185bf313654e903207a3fc2d5f261

That "(null)" is not from git, but from glibc in response to NULL
passed for %s.  It might
as well crash (as some other libc do) or send in the marines.
